.svc-section[data-astro-cid-kh7btl4r]{position:relative;overflow:hidden}.about-hero[data-astro-cid-kh7btl4r]{position:relative;isolation:isolate;padding:clamp(96px,14vw,180px) 0 clamp(64px,9vw,112px);overflow:hidden;border-bottom:1px solid var(--border)}.about-hero-bg[data-astro-cid-kh7btl4r]{position:absolute;inset:0;pointer-events:none;z-index:0;overflow:hidden}.about-hero-img[data-astro-cid-kh7btl4r]{position:absolute;inset:-6%;background-image:url(/images/page-bg-about.png);background-size:cover;background-position:center;background-repeat:no-repeat;opacity:.85;filter:saturate(1.1) brightness(.9);animation:aboutHeroPan 70s ease-in-out infinite alternate;will-change:transform}@keyframes aboutHeroPan{0%{transform:scale(1.04) translate3d(-.5%,-.5%,0)}50%{transform:scale(1.1) translate3d(1.2%,.8%,0)}to{transform:scale(1.06) translate3d(-1%,1%,0)}}.about-hero-glow[data-astro-cid-kh7btl4r]{position:absolute;left:0;top:50%;width:900px;height:600px;transform:translateY(-50%);background:radial-gradient(ellipse 60% 60% at 50% 50%,var(--accent-soft),transparent 70%);filter:blur(60px);opacity:.4}.about-hero-stars[data-astro-cid-kh7btl4r]{position:absolute;inset:0;background-image:radial-gradient(1px 1px at 12% 22%,rgba(255,255,255,.5),transparent 50%),radial-gradient(1px 1px at 34% 64%,rgba(251,191,36,.6),transparent 50%),radial-gradient(1.5px 1.5px at 62% 88%,rgba(255,255,255,.45),transparent 50%),radial-gradient(1px 1px at 78% 14%,rgba(251,191,36,.5),transparent 50%),radial-gradient(1px 1px at 92% 60%,rgba(255,255,255,.4),transparent 50%);background-size:100% 100%;opacity:.7;animation:aboutStarsTwinkle 6s ease-in-out infinite alternate}@keyframes aboutStarsTwinkle{0%,to{opacity:.55}50%{opacity:.95;filter:brightness(1.3)}}.about-hero-pixels[data-astro-cid-kh7btl4r]{position:absolute;inset:0;background-image:radial-gradient(2px 2px at 10% 85%,rgba(244,114,182,.75),transparent 50%),radial-gradient(1.5px 1.5px at 28% 92%,rgba(244,244,245,.7),transparent 50%),radial-gradient(2px 2px at 44% 78%,rgba(196,132,252,.7),transparent 50%),radial-gradient(1.5px 1.5px at 62% 95%,rgba(251,191,36,.8),transparent 50%),radial-gradient(2px 2px at 78% 80%,rgba(244,114,182,.65),transparent 50%),radial-gradient(1px 1px at 92% 88%,rgba(244,244,245,.6),transparent 50%);background-size:100% 200%;animation:aboutPixelDrift 22s linear infinite;mix-blend-mode:screen}@keyframes aboutPixelDrift{0%{background-position:0% 0%}to{background-position:0% -200%}}.about-hero-scrim[data-astro-cid-kh7btl4r]{position:absolute;left:0;top:50%;width:min(720px,60%);height:460px;transform:translateY(-50%);background:radial-gradient(ellipse 70% 60% at 30% 50%,rgba(10,10,12,.72) 0%,rgba(10,10,12,.5) 35%,rgba(10,10,12,.2) 65%,transparent 100%);filter:blur(8px)}@media(prefers-reduced-motion:reduce){.about-hero-img[data-astro-cid-kh7btl4r],.about-hero-stars[data-astro-cid-kh7btl4r],.about-hero-pixels[data-astro-cid-kh7btl4r]{animation:none}}.about-hero-inner[data-astro-cid-kh7btl4r]{position:relative;z-index:1;display:grid;grid-template-columns:1.1fr 1fr;gap:clamp(40px,6vw,96px);align-items:center}@media(max-width:920px){.about-hero-inner[data-astro-cid-kh7btl4r]{grid-template-columns:1fr;gap:48px}}.about-hero-eyebrow-row[data-astro-cid-kh7btl4r]{display:flex;align-items:center;gap:14px;flex-wrap:wrap}.about-hero-tag[data-astro-cid-kh7btl4r]{font-family:var(--font-mono);font-size:10.5px;letter-spacing:.16em;text-transform:uppercase;color:var(--accent);padding:4px 10px;border-radius:100px;border:1px solid var(--accent);background:var(--accent-soft)}.about-hero-title[data-astro-cid-kh7btl4r]{margin:24px 0;font-size:clamp(2.5rem,6vw,4.5rem);letter-spacing:-.025em}.about-hero-sub[data-astro-cid-kh7btl4r]{max-width:520px;color:var(--text-muted);font-size:clamp(16px,1.4vw,19px);line-height:1.55;text-wrap:balance}.about-hero-sub[data-astro-cid-kh7btl4r] strong[data-astro-cid-kh7btl4r]{color:var(--text);font-weight:500}.about-status[data-astro-cid-kh7btl4r]{background:linear-gradient(180deg,var(--surface) 0%,var(--bg) 120%);border:1px solid var(--border);border-radius:18px;overflow:hidden;box-shadow:0 40px 100px -30px #000000b3,0 0 80px -20px var(--accent-soft);position:relative}.about-status[data-astro-cid-kh7btl4r]:before{content:"";position:absolute;inset:0;background:radial-gradient(800px 200px at 50% 0%,var(--accent-soft),transparent 70%);pointer-events:none}.about-status-bar[data-astro-cid-kh7btl4r]{position:relative;display:flex;align-items:center;justify-content:space-between;gap:12px;padding:12px 16px;border-bottom:1px solid var(--border);background:#ffffff04;z-index:1}.about-status-bar[data-astro-cid-kh7btl4r] .ops-dots[data-astro-cid-kh7btl4r]{display:flex;gap:6px}.about-status-bar[data-astro-cid-kh7btl4r] .ops-dots[data-astro-cid-kh7btl4r] span[data-astro-cid-kh7btl4r]{width:10px;height:10px;border-radius:50%;background:var(--border-strong)}.about-status-bar[data-astro-cid-kh7btl4r] .ops-dots[data-astro-cid-kh7btl4r] span[data-astro-cid-kh7btl4r]:first-child{background:#52525b}.about-status-title[data-astro-cid-kh7btl4r]{font-family:var(--font-mono);font-size:12px;color:var(--text-dim);letter-spacing:.02em}.about-status-live[data-astro-cid-kh7btl4r]{display:inline-flex;align-items:center;gap:8px;font-family:var(--font-mono);font-size:11px;color:#34d399;letter-spacing:.04em}.about-status-rows[data-astro-cid-kh7btl4r]{position:relative;background:var(--border);display:flex;flex-direction:column;gap:1px;z-index:1}.about-status-row[data-astro-cid-kh7btl4r]{display:grid;grid-template-columns:auto 1fr auto;gap:14px;align-items:center;padding:16px 18px;background:var(--surface)}.about-status-icon[data-astro-cid-kh7btl4r]{display:inline-flex;align-items:center;justify-content:center;width:32px;height:32px;border-radius:8px;background:var(--accent-soft);color:var(--accent)}.about-status-info[data-astro-cid-kh7btl4r]{display:flex;flex-direction:column;gap:2px}.about-status-name[data-astro-cid-kh7btl4r]{font-family:var(--font-display);font-size:15.5px;font-weight:600;letter-spacing:-.02em;color:var(--text)}.about-status-sub[data-astro-cid-kh7btl4r]{font-family:var(--font-mono);font-size:11.5px;color:var(--text-dim)}.about-status-tag[data-astro-cid-kh7btl4r]{font-family:var(--font-mono);font-size:10.5px;letter-spacing:.04em;padding:3px 9px;border-radius:100px;border:1px solid var(--border-strong)}.about-status-tag[data-astro-cid-kh7btl4r].tag-green{color:#34d399;border-color:#34d39940;background:#34d3990f}.about-status-tag[data-astro-cid-kh7btl4r].tag-amber{color:#fbbf24;border-color:#fbbf2440;background:#fbbf240f}.about-status-tag[data-astro-cid-kh7btl4r].tag-blue{color:var(--accent);border-color:#3b82f64d;background:var(--accent-soft)}.about-status-foot[data-astro-cid-kh7btl4r]{position:relative;display:grid;grid-template-columns:repeat(4,1fr);gap:1px;background:var(--border);z-index:1}.about-status-stat[data-astro-cid-kh7btl4r]{background:var(--surface);padding:16px 18px;display:flex;flex-direction:column;gap:4px}.about-status-stat-label[data-astro-cid-kh7btl4r]{font-family:var(--font-mono);font-size:10px;letter-spacing:.18em;text-transform:uppercase;color:var(--text-dim)}.about-status-stat-value[data-astro-cid-kh7btl4r]{font-family:var(--font-display);font-size:18px;font-weight:600;color:var(--text);letter-spacing:-.02em}@media(max-width:560px){.about-status-foot[data-astro-cid-kh7btl4r]{grid-template-columns:1fr 1fr}}.origin-grid[data-astro-cid-kh7btl4r]{display:grid;grid-template-columns:1.2fr 1fr;gap:64px;align-items:start}@media(max-width:920px){.origin-grid[data-astro-cid-kh7btl4r]{grid-template-columns:1fr;gap:40px}}.origin-copy[data-astro-cid-kh7btl4r] h2[data-astro-cid-kh7btl4r]{margin:16px 0 24px;font-size:clamp(28px,3.4vw,40px);letter-spacing:-.025em}.origin-body[data-astro-cid-kh7btl4r]{display:flex;flex-direction:column;gap:18px;color:var(--text-muted);font-size:16px;line-height:1.7}.origin-body[data-astro-cid-kh7btl4r] strong[data-astro-cid-kh7btl4r]{color:var(--text);font-weight:500}.origin-timeline[data-astro-cid-kh7btl4r]{list-style:none;margin:0;border-left:1px solid var(--border);padding:0 0 0 28px;position:relative}.origin-timeline-item[data-astro-cid-kh7btl4r]{display:grid;grid-template-columns:auto 1fr;grid-template-rows:auto auto;column-gap:12px;padding-bottom:28px;position:relative}.origin-timeline-item[data-astro-cid-kh7btl4r]:last-child{padding-bottom:0}.origin-timeline-year[data-astro-cid-kh7btl4r]{grid-column:1 / 2;grid-row:1 / 2;font-family:var(--font-mono);font-size:11px;letter-spacing:.18em;text-transform:uppercase;color:var(--accent)}.origin-timeline-dot[data-astro-cid-kh7btl4r]{position:absolute;left:-33px;top:4px;width:10px;height:10px;border-radius:50%;background:var(--accent);box-shadow:0 0 14px var(--accent-glow)}.origin-timeline-label[data-astro-cid-kh7btl4r]{grid-column:2 / 3;grid-row:1 / 2;font-family:var(--font-display);font-size:16px;font-weight:600;color:var(--text);letter-spacing:-.01em}.origin-timeline-body[data-astro-cid-kh7btl4r]{grid-column:1 / -1;grid-row:2 / 3;margin-top:8px;color:var(--text-muted);font-size:14.5px;line-height:1.6}.svc-section-head[data-astro-cid-kh7btl4r]{max-width:720px;margin:0 auto 56px;text-align:center;display:flex;flex-direction:column;gap:16px}.principles-grid[data-astro-cid-kh7btl4r]{display:grid;grid-template-columns:repeat(2,1fr);gap:20px;max-width:1080px;margin:0 auto}@media(max-width:820px){.principles-grid[data-astro-cid-kh7btl4r]{grid-template-columns:1fr}}.principle-card[data-astro-cid-kh7btl4r]{position:relative;background:var(--surface);border:1px solid var(--border);border-radius:18px;padding:32px;display:flex;flex-direction:column;gap:12px;overflow:hidden}.principle-card-icon[data-astro-cid-kh7btl4r]{margin-bottom:8px;display:inline-flex;align-items:center;justify-content:center;width:44px;height:44px;border-radius:10px;background:var(--accent-soft);color:var(--accent)}.principle-num[data-astro-cid-kh7btl4r]{font-family:var(--font-mono);font-size:11px;letter-spacing:.18em;text-transform:uppercase;color:var(--accent)}.principle-title[data-astro-cid-kh7btl4r]{font-size:22px;margin:0;letter-spacing:-.02em}.principle-body[data-astro-cid-kh7btl4r]{color:var(--text-muted);font-size:15px;line-height:1.65}.about-team-section[data-astro-cid-kh7btl4r]{position:relative}.wide-body[data-astro-cid-kh7btl4r]{max-width:760px;margin:0 auto;display:flex;flex-direction:column;gap:20px;color:var(--text-muted);font-size:clamp(16px,1.4vw,18px);line-height:1.7}.wide-body-note[data-astro-cid-kh7btl4r]{font-size:13px;color:var(--text-dim);font-style:italic}.audience-wrap[data-astro-cid-kh7btl4r]{display:grid;grid-template-columns:1.5fr 1fr;gap:48px;align-items:start;max-width:1080px;margin:0 auto}@media(max-width:820px){.audience-wrap[data-astro-cid-kh7btl4r]{grid-template-columns:1fr;gap:28px}}.audience-card[data-astro-cid-kh7btl4r]{background:var(--surface);border:1px solid var(--border);border-radius:18px;padding:32px;display:flex;flex-direction:column;gap:14px;position:relative}.audience-list[data-astro-cid-kh7btl4r]{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:10px}.audience-list[data-astro-cid-kh7btl4r] li[data-astro-cid-kh7btl4r]{position:relative;padding-left:20px;color:var(--text);font-size:14.5px;line-height:1.5}.audience-list[data-astro-cid-kh7btl4r] li[data-astro-cid-kh7btl4r]:before{content:"";position:absolute;left:0;top:9px;width:8px;height:1px;background:var(--accent)}.audience-cta[data-astro-cid-kh7btl4r]{margin-top:48px;display:flex;justify-content:flex-start}.team-grid[data-astro-cid-kh7btl4r]{display:grid;grid-template-columns:repeat(3,1fr);gap:20px;max-width:1080px;margin:40px auto 0}@media(max-width:820px){.team-grid[data-astro-cid-kh7btl4r]{grid-template-columns:1fr}}.team-card[data-astro-cid-kh7btl4r]{background:var(--surface);border:1px solid var(--border);border-radius:18px;padding:28px;display:flex;flex-direction:column;gap:16px}.team-avatar[data-astro-cid-kh7btl4r]{width:56px;height:56px;border-radius:50%;background:oklch(45% .18 var(--avatar-hue, 220));color:#fff;font-family:var(--font-display);font-size:16px;font-weight:700;letter-spacing:.02em;display:flex;align-items:center;justify-content:center;flex-shrink:0}.team-info[data-astro-cid-kh7btl4r]{display:flex;flex-direction:column;gap:4px}.team-name[data-astro-cid-kh7btl4r]{font-family:var(--font-display);font-size:17px;font-weight:600;color:var(--text);letter-spacing:-.02em}.team-role[data-astro-cid-kh7btl4r]{font-family:var(--font-mono);font-size:11px;letter-spacing:.12em;text-transform:uppercase;color:var(--accent)}.team-bio[data-astro-cid-kh7btl4r]{margin-top:6px;color:var(--text-muted);font-size:14px;line-height:1.6}
